The Austria 1 oz Gold Philharmonic Coin is a stunning representation of both artistry and investment potential. Struck by the Austrian Mint, this coin boasts a remarkable purity of .9999 fine gold, ensuring its status as a premier choice for investors and collectors alike. Weighing 1 troy ounce (31.1035 grams) and measuring 37.0 mm in diameter with a thickness of 2.0 mm, it is both substantial and visually striking. The obverse features the Great Organ of the Vienna Musikverein, a tribute to Austria's illustrious musical tradition, designed by renowned engraver Thomas Pesendorfer. The reverse presents a harmonious arrangement of musical instruments, symbolizing the Vienna Philharmonic Orchestra, further enhancing its cultural significance.
As an investment, the Gold Philharmonic Coin is backed by the Austrian government, providing a sovereign guarantee that adds to its appeal. Its eligibility for Precious Metals IRAs under IRC Section 408(m) makes it a strategic choice for those looking to diversify their retirement portfolios with tangible assets. The global liquidity of gold, combined with the coin's artistic value, positions it as a sought-after item in the precious metals market.

The obverse of the Austria Gold Philharmonic Coin features the Great Organ of the Vienna Musikverein, symbolizing the rich musical heritage of Austria. The design is attributed to the engraver Thomas Pesendorfer, and it includes the inscription 'Republik Österreich' (Republic of Austria).
The reverse showcases a collection of musical instruments, including a cello, violin, and harp, representing the Vienna Philharmonic Orchestra. This design is also by Thomas Pesendorfer and is accompanied by the denomination and year of issue.
